Standing Firm on Scripture: The Cornerstones of Baptist Belief
Baptists affirm to certain fundamental principles that guide their faith and practice. These teachings are steadfastly rooted in the scriptures, seen to be the inspired voice of God.
- The sole source of authority for faith and life is the Bible.
- The ordinance of baptism|Immersion is a essential act of conviction.
- The church consists of autonomous congregations led by elders.
These core principles, when embraced, lead Baptists traditional baptist church toward a life of obedience to Christ and ministry to the world.

Elevating Voices: A Look at Music in Baptist Worship
Music has always played a vital role in Baptist worship, providing a powerful means for expressing adoration to the Lord. From the earliest days of the movement, Baptists have recognized the transformative power of song to lift hearts, strengthen faith, and create a sense of unity among believers.
Throughout the diverse tapestry of Baptist congregations, music manifests in various forms. Traditional hymns, abounding with biblical themes and stirring melodies, continue to hold a cherished place in many services. Contemporary worship songs, often characterized by their energetic rhythms and relatable lyrics, resonate deeply with younger generations.
Furthermore these styles, Baptists also embrace gospel music, spirituals, and other genres that express the joy and salvation found in Christ. The common thread weaving through all these musical expressions is a deep commitment to glorifying God through song.
